g Victoria (1837-1901), ´Una and the Lion´ Five Pounds, 1839, by W. Wyon, young head left, 9 leaves to rear fillet of hair band, victoria d: g; britanniarum regina f: d:, rev. the young Queen as Una, crowned, holding orb and sceptre, leading the lion left, date in exergue, dirige deus gressus meos., edge lettered (WR 279; S.3851), minor edge knocks, light surface marks on neck and in fields, otherwise with an attractive old golden tone and considerable brilliance, good extremely fine, and rare Estimate £ 18,000-20,000
